Materials You Will Need:
Before diving into the crochet, ensure you have all the necessary materials gathered. This will streamline the process and prevent interruptions. You'll need:
Yarn: Choose a yarn weight that suits your preference. A medium-weight (worsted weight) yarn is a good starting point for beginners, as it's easy to work with and provides a nice, substantial fabric. Consider festive colors like red, green, gold, or silver for a New Year's theme, or opt for a classic neutral tone for a more timeless look. Approximately 50-75 yards should be sufficient depending on your phone size.
Crochet Hook: Select a crochet hook size that corresponds to your chosen yarn weight. The yarn label usually indicates the recommended hook size. Using the correct hook size ensures the finished fabric has the correct tension and drape.
Scissors: A sharp pair of scissors will be essential for cutting the yarn.
Yarn Needle: A yarn needle (a blunt-ended needle with a large eye) will be used for weaving in the ends of your yarn.
Measuring Tape: Measure your phone to determine the dimensions for your case.
Phone: This is crucial! You'll need it to ensure the case fits properly.
Gauge and Sizing:
While a precise gauge isn't critical for this project, it's beneficial to create a small swatch before beginning the main body of the case. This will help you get a feel for your tension and make adjustments if necessary. Your phone's dimensions will dictate the final size of your crochet piece. Measure your phone's length, width, and thickness to determine the appropriate number of stitches and rows.
Instructions:
Foundation Chain:
Begin by creating a foundation chain that is approximately 1 inch longer than the width of your phone. This will account for seam allowance. The exact number of chains will depend on your yarn and hook size, and the width of your phone.
First Row:
Work a single crochet (sc) stitch in the second chain from the hook and in each chain across. This forms your first row.
Following Rows:
Continue working in single crochet stitches for the remaining rows. The number of rows needed will depend on the length of your phone. You'll want the finished piece to be long enough to comfortably envelop your phone, leaving a little extra space at the top and bottom for easy access.
Finishing the Case:
Once you've reached the desired length, fasten off your yarn, leaving a tail for weaving in. You now have a rectangular piece of crochet fabric. Carefully fold the fabric around your phone, ensuring it fits snugly but not too tightly.
Seaming:
Using a yarn needle, carefully seam the two long sides of the rectangular fabric together using a slip stitch or mattress stitch. Ensure the seams are neat and even. Leave an opening at either the top or bottom of the phone case for easy access.

Weaving in Ends:
Finally, carefully weave in all loose ends of yarn using your yarn needle. This will ensure your finished phone case looks neat and professional.
Tips for Beginners:
Practice: If you're new to crochet, practice your single crochet stitches on a scrap piece of yarn before starting the phone case. This will help you get comfortable with the technique.
Watch Videos: Numerous helpful crochet tutorials are available online, visually demonstrating the techniques.
Don't Be Afraid to Make Mistakes: Mistakes happen! Don't get discouraged if you make a mistake. Simply unravel your work and start again.
